  • Hi is the filter in your via aqua noisy with the water flowing back into the tank? If it is then is there a way to quieten it? Im considering getting one but it will be going in my bedroom :)

  • @stacykym

    hi this is in my bedroom & i dont have a problem, it depends how sensitive you are. there is a low humming but as long as you keep it topped up you should not have a problem with water trickling. i have to top it up every 3-4 days as i find the water actually evaporates quickly. if you dont want to fill it right up to the top like i do then i think you can get an attachment which connects to the outflow and takes the water comming out to below the waterline to prevent trickling.
